Nuclear Engineer - 24-004 - San Diego, CA


As a growing Department of Defense Contractor, AUSGAR Technologies has an exciting, new opportunity for a Nuclear Engineer to join our team of smart and innovative technical team members at NIWC PAC - Bayside in the Point Loma area of San Diego, CA.

Support the SSC PAC Radiation Detection, Implementation and Computation (RADIAC) program in the design, development and deployment of radiation detection system. Will collaborate with an interdisciplinary team of technicians, engineers and scientists to research detection technologies, interface with users to understand needs and requirements and field complete radiation detection solutions.


Specific Duties and Functions include:

  • Provide engineering support, process management and quality assurance for the RADIAC project.
  • Provide technical analyses for the research, design, development and modeling for the production, maintenance, changes and modifications and other related services for RADIAC systems.
  • Interface with and support RADIAC system users in various training events and exercises.
  • Develop technical descriptions and materials for RADIAC systems.
Requirements


The physical demands and work environment described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of the job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Must possess or be able to obtain a Secret clearance.
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in Nuclear Engineering, Physics or related degree from an accredited college/university and six months plus of related experience or the equivalent combination of education, professional training and work experience.
  • Experience conducting research and development in the areas of radiation detection and related technologies required.
  • Experience in radiation detection system design and integration preferred.
  • Knowledge in radiation science and nuclear engineering and related discipline preferred.
  • Working knowledge in scripting and analysis software language like MATLAB and python preferred.
  • Experience in working with DoD users preferred.
  • Ability to work in a small team environment.
  • Strong analytical/problem solving capability.
  • Strong oral and written communication skills.
  • Expected travel up to 10%.

Salary Range: $80-95K
